SANREMO, 01 FEB – “Talking about records, about ten days before the end of the Festival, seems a bit premature to me. We are absolutely satisfied, because the credibility of Amadeus is total and the market is following us very well”. This was stated by the managing director of Rai Pubblicità, Gian Paolo Tagliavia, on the sidelines of the press conference “Between the stage and the city, local initiatives of the 73rd Italian Song Festival”. Thus Tagliavia replied to the question of whether the forecasts on the possibility of a record year for Rai’s advertising revenue linked to the Festival are reliable, we are talking – according to estimates by the Sole 24 Ore – of around fifty million. “Sunday morning, after the final, we could give definitive figures,” he added. Is the figure reliable? “Reliable – he said – is an adverb that has various nuances, but let’s say that we are on the right track”. (HANDLE).
